OUR JAPANESE ALLIES

-a I I FELICITOUS SPEECHES 'AT PERTH. Perth, June 9. Admiral Ghisaka,. oi the Japanese -1 training squadron, in a. speech at a J junclieon given to the Governor (Ma-jor-General Sir Harry Barton), said lie firmly believed that tlie Anglo-Jap-anese Treaty would last until eternity. Tho Governer, in replying, said it , had been often asked why tho services of Japanese soldiers had not been utilised; tho truth was that the Allies did not need them, but they, knew that , they were ready and willing the'mo- i ment tho word'for aid went forth. g
